
The Role of IT in Transforming Modern Businesses

In today’s digital-first environment, IT isn’t merely a support department; it’s a core driver of business transformation. From cloud-based solutions to digital automation, IT enables companies to streamline their processes, scale operations, and make data-driven decisions. As industries evolve, the strategic integration of IT is essential for any business aiming to stay competitive and relevant.
A key benefit of IT in business transformation is its ability to improve operational efficiency. With the right IT infrastructure, tasks that once took days or even weeks can now be completed in minutes. Take cloud computing as an example. It allows businesses to store vast amounts of data without the need for physical servers, making data storage more accessible, affordable, and secure. Businesses can then access this data remotely, enabling flexibility and continuity, especially in today’s remote-first work culture.
Furthermore, IT supports data analytics and real-time decision-making. Advanced software solutions collect and process data on customer preferences, market trends, and operational performance. By analyzing these datasets, businesses gain actionable insights that can inform everything from marketing strategies to product development. Decision-makers can respond to trends more rapidly, fine-tune strategies, and meet market demands with precision.
One of IT’s most transformative roles is in automation. Through IT-driven solutions, companies can automate repetitive tasks such as data entry, payroll, and customer communications. Automation not only reduces human error but also allows employees to focus on higher-value tasks, such as customer service and strategy, ultimately enhancing productivity.
Cybersecurity is another area where IT is essential. As digital threats become increasingly sophisticated, having robust security protocols in place is non-negotiable. IT enables businesses to secure sensitive data, protect customer information, and adhere to regulatory compliance. For modern businesses, cybersecurity measures such as encryption, multi-factor authentication, and constant network monitoring are integral to maintaining trust and reliability.
In sum, IT has become indispensable in driving business innovation and resilience. By enabling automation, facilitating data analytics, and providing robust security, IT transforms traditional businesses into agile, future-ready enterprises.
